Output 3567d52389754faaf4b643a002537e3d62d8cdeb1718c02859ca21f2d5cb2906:1

value
18544978
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cf513fb114f2aadaa9baeef0f5df93bb30ea166 OP_EQUALVERIFY OP_CHECKSIG
address
1Aw7a3GZNKYufHrma7pXit5JoMAmW8KVEZ
transaction
3567d52389754faaf4b643a002537e3d62d8cdeb1718c02859ca21f2d5cb2906
spent
true